1. Ripley
First on our list is the county seat, Ripley. This quaint town is the epitome of Southern charm, with its historic downtown, friendly locals, and a strong sense of community. Ripley is also home to First Monday Trade Day, a monthly event that attracts visitors from all over the region. 🏘️🛍️

- What is the cost of living in Tippah County? The cost of living in Tippah County is lower than the national average, making it an affordable place to live.
- What is the weather like in Tippah County? Tippah County experiences a humid subtropical climate, with hot summers and mild winters.
- What are the main industries in Tippah County? The main industries in Tippah County are manufacturing, retail trade, and healthcare.
